 COCONUT MILK RASAM




Rasam is  thin, soup-like dish that are very popular in South India. Most of the rasam varieties are beneficial for the health as they are good for curing colds and coughs. On this post, I have shared one of my favorite rasam recipes, Coconut Milk Rasam, a specialty from Tamil Nadu. Made with thick coconut milk, tamarind extract, rasam powder and spices. 

This coconut milk rasam is cherished for its creamy texture, coconut flavor, and a perfect blend of tanginess and spiciness.




Ingredients:

Coconut - 1 shell
Tamarind- Amla sized 
Tomato - 1 small size 
Shallots - 5
Garlic - 4 
Green chilli - 1
Mustard seeds - 1 tsp
Coriander leaves -a handful 
Turmeric powder - 1 tsp
Pepper powder - 1 tsp
Jeera powder - 1 tsp
Salt to taste
Coconut oil - 1 tbsp
Curry leaves - 2 springs 
Asafoetida powder- a pinch 

Preparation:

1. Wash and Soak tamarind in water and squeeze out the tamarind paste and keep it aside.
2. Make 2 cups of coconut milk from fresh coconut. 
3. Coarse grind shallots ,garlic , green chilli, coriander leaves.
4. Take a bowl and add Fresh coconut milk, tamarind paste, turmeric powder, jeera powder, pepper powder. Mix everything well and keep it aside.
5. In a pan, add coconut oil, once the oil heats add mustard seeds, wen it splits , add curry leaves and shallots paste ( the one we made already), saute it.
6. Shallots and garlic sauted in coconut oil gives nice aroma. 
7. Now add finely chopped tomato den the coconut milk mix (step : 4)
8. Add salt and a pinch of asafoetida powder den garnish with coriander leaves.
9. After adding coconut milk, just make one boil else the coconut milk will curdle… 
10. Serve with hot rice , personally I would prefer with fish fry or potato fry. Any fryums taste good with this rasam .

Tip:

        1. While making coconut milk it’s not necessary to take thick milk , it can be in running consistency.
        2. While boiling rasam, we should just give one boil else the rasam will curdle.
